YOUR DAY TO DAY: You will be able to learn what it takes to produce a network newscast, from its planning stages in the editorial meeting to the execution of a live show in the control room. You will obtain hands-on experience working closely with producers creating elements for stories that will air on national television. You will be able to pitch stories for shows and help produce them along with our network reporters. You will get to work with all roles in a newsroom including anchors, producers, technical crews, writers, graphic designers, editors and many more.

Responsibilities

  • Assist on daily show rundown, development of supers, banners, and graphics.
  • Work closely with executive producers, producers, and associate producers to build rundowns.
  • Join editorial meetings and participate in the planning and production of network newscasts.
  • Work closely with producers and provide suggestions on the production of stories.
  • Research information and materials necessary for production.
  • Assist in the planning of recording segments for air.
  • Help research background information for anchor and reporter interviews.
  • Help produce elements for daily newscasts.
  • There will be a group innovation project assigned to all interns at the beginning of the program where you will be working cross functionally and present the ideas at the end of the program to an executive committee.
